WebThe scales read "1 kg" when there is nothing on them; You always measure your height wearing shoes with thick soles. A stopwatch that takes half a second to stop when clicked; In each case all measurements are wrong by the same amount. That is bias. Degree of Accuracy. Predicted values (separated by commas) Actual values (separated by commas) Find out what a good accuracy … WebFor example, a 100 psi gauge with 0.1 % of FS accuracy would be accurate to ± 0.1 psi across its entire range. By convention, a gauge specified as 0.1% accuracy is implied to be 0.1% FS. When manufacturers define their accuracy as “% of reading”, they are describing the accuracy as a percentage of the reading currently displayed.
